Precisely. Ireland, with a population of 4.97 million, has Dublin as its capital. English and Irish are its official languages. Japan, in contrast, has a population of 126.5 million, with Tokyo as its capital and Japanese as the sole official language. We'll explore further aspects of these unique cultures.
